
The BMS01 is a battery master switch designed for dangerous goods road vehicles complying with international ADR regulations. Environmental protection and the intrinsically safe control circuitry of the BMS01 are in accordance with ADR 2009. The battery switch must be installed between the battery and the vehicle’s electrical system. It is operated on and off by means of a control switch in the driver’s cab, additional control switches can be sited around the vehicle as required. The BMS01 is a double pole device, but can be connected as 1-pole version (see connection diagram).
An integral safety barrier permits siting of the BMS01 in hazardous areas. Additional auxiliary contacts are provided for disconnection of the ignition circuit, de-energisation of the alternator field winding, or a controlled shutdown of the CANBUS system followed after a delay by disconnection of the battery.
